Job Description:

This role will provide critical support for the establishment and maintenance of JJM APAC’s overall commercial quality management framework and quality system. This will be achieved through establishing preventive and corrective actions to mitigate potential or actual non-compliance risks, ensuring compliance to attain world-class operational/customer-focused capabilities, product safety and regulatory compliance.

This position reports to the Director, Quality Systems & Strategy, Commercial Quality, JJMT APAC.

Key Responsibilities :

  • Work with the Director, Quality Systems and APAC’s Quality community, ensuring a proactive approach to quality assurance and quality systems.

  • Assist with the development of appropriate strategic and process performance measures and targets.

  • Work with the HMD, and J&J Quality & Compliance groups and the APAC Quality community, to ensure a proactive approach compliance to all quality standards and regulatory requirements, leveraging knowledge to transfer quality tools and programs.

  • Lead quality initiatives through deployment of automated systems within J&J APAC region to improve compliance and efficiency for Quality System Management.

  • Support engagement of Commercial Leadership to ensure recognition of their quality responsibilities and to provide robust Quality Systems in APAC.

  • Demonstrate a high level of cross-cultural sensitivity, understanding of market product needs from consumer / affordability perspectives, including local market promotion / marketing compliance.

  • Engage all company employees in quality initiatives, through interactive project mentoring/consulting and change management strategies.

  • Lead quality investigations and internal audits of J&J APAC countries to assess risks and conformance to J&J requirements, specifications, commercial quality procedures, and overall compliance to regulations both internally and for J&J service suppliers.

  • Lead and participate in initiatives to improve the compliance and management of the distribution of Loaner Sets.

  • Lead and participate in initiatives to improve the compliance and management of local Repack/Relabel activities.

  • Lead and participate in initiatives to improve the compliance and management of local Rework activities.

  • Provide support in the deployment, use and training of electronic systems.

  • Lead and participate in initiatives to utilize digital, data and analytics to improve efficiency and effectiveness of quality systems.
